WebInvented in 132AD by Zhang Heng, the seismograph is an ancient Chinese invention. It detects the grounds activity during an earthquake. and predicts the direction of a quake, even if it was thousands of miles away. Scientists in Europe only began development of seismographs in the 19th century. WebJun 11, 2024 · Paper. ViewStock / Getty Images. Paper was another Han invention.
